Waldorf Cabbage Salad

By: Erik Owens 
"My dad always made this for Thanksgiving and Christmas. He called it Waldorf Salad, but it is really a cabbage salad 'Waldorf style'."

Original Recipe Yield 4 to 6 servings
 

Ingredients

  • 1/4 head savoy cabbage, thinly sliced
  • 4 apples, cored and diced with peel
  • 1/2 cup finely chopped walnuts
  • 6 stalks celery, diced
  • 1/3 cup mayonnaise
  • 1 tablespoon white sugar
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t

Directions

  1. Use a chef's knife to slice cabbage into thin pieces 1 to 2 inches long. Do not use the large ribs of the cabbage, as they are too strongly flavored.
  2. In a large bowl, toss together the cabbage, apples, walnuts, celery, mayonnaise, sugar and salt until evenly coated. Serve immediately or store in the refrigerator for up to one day.
